Overview

""Report On Civic Cleanliness and the Economical Disposition of the Refuse of Cities"" by Egbert Ludovicus Viele offers a comprehensive overview of urban sanitation practices in the early 20th century. This meticulously detailed report examines the challenges of maintaining cleanliness in rapidly growing cities and proposes economical methods for managing waste. Viele's work provides valuable insights into the historical context of urban planning and public health, addressing issues such as waste disposal, street cleaning, and the overall impact of sanitation on community well-being. This report is not only a historical document but also a relevant resource for contemporary discussions on sustainable urban development and environmental conservation. It serves as a reminder of the importance of effective waste management and its profound influence on the health and prosperity of urban populations. Scholars and practitioners alike will find this work an invaluable contribution to understanding the evolution of civic hygiene.
